Perfect as a country house! Come and discover this former 18th century water mill in a charming little hamlet in the commune of Saint-Fraigne, just 20 km from Ruffec . The beautifully landscaped garden on the banks of the River Aume (with the right to draw water from the millstream) is a haven of peace.

The house has 169 m of living space is in need of renovation. The kitchen floor, electricity, attic insulation and cracks need to be repaired (estimate for structural consolidation). The ground floor comprises a lounge opening onto a charming dining room, a kitchen, a shower room/wc and a second lounge with a wood-burning stove.

Upstairs, a landing leads to a master bedroom with bathroom and small dressing room, a second bedroom, a shower room/wc and a study area. In addition, the property has an outbuilding of approx. 100 m , with a small plot of land adjoining, which could be renovated into a private dwelling, a workshop, a garage...
